Type-C接口选型实战指南:从24P到6P的硬件设计精要
Type-C接口的普及让"一口通吃"成为可能,但面对24P、16P、6P三种主流规格,硬件开发者常陷入选择困境。上周有位做智能门锁的客户就踩了坑——为了节省成本选用6P接口,结果产品无法通过PD充电器供电,导致首批5000套主板全部返工。这种"省小钱赔大钱"的案例在硬件圈屡见不鲜。本文将带你穿透规格参数的表象,从实际产品需求出发,构建一套科学的选型方法论。
1. 三种接口的物理特性与成本分析
1.1 引脚配置的实质差异
24P Type-C是完整功能的旗舰规格,其引脚配置就像瑞士军刀般全面:
24P典型引脚分布: ├── 电源组(4×VBUS, 4×GND) ├── USB3.1高速通道(4×SSTX, 4×SSRX) ├── USB2.0基础通道(D+/D-) ├── 配置通道(CC1/CC2) └── 边带信号(SBU1/SBU2)16P版本则像精准瘦身后的商务版,砍掉了USB3.x相关引脚:
16P精简方案: ├── 电源组(2×VBUS, 2×GND) ├── USB2.0基础通道(D+/D-) ├── 配置通道(CC1/CC2) └── 边带信号(SBU1/SBU2)而6P版本堪称极简主义的代表,仅保留最核心的电力传输功能:
6P最小系统: ├── 电源组(2×VBUS, 2×GND) └── 配置通道(CC1/CC2)1.2 采购与制造成本对比
通过对比华南市场2023年Q4的报价数据,可见不同规格的成本梯度:
| 规格 | 接口单价 | PCB面积 | 焊接难度 | 总装成本 |
|---|---|---|---|---|
| 24P | ¥2.8-3.5 | 8.4mm² | 高 | ¥4.2-5.0 |
| 16P | ¥1.2-1.8 | 5.6mm² | 中 | ¥2.5-3.2 |
| 6P | ¥0.6-0.9 | 3.2mm² | 低 | ¥1.0-1.5 |
提示:总装成本含ESD防护元件费用,24P通常需要TVS二极管阵列
1.3 工艺要求差异
- 24P焊接:需要0.4mm间距QFN工艺,建议采用:
- 钢网厚度0.1mm
- 锡膏型号SAC305
- 回流焊峰值温度245±5℃
- 16P焊接:0.5mm间距可手工补焊
- 6P焊接:通孔插件式设计兼容波峰焊
2. 应用场景的黄金匹配法则
2.1 必须选择24P的三种情况
当你的产品符合以下任一特征时,24P是唯一选择:
- 高速数据传输:需支持USB3.2 Gen2(10Gbps)或雷电3协议
- 多功能复用:同时需要视频输出(DP Alt Mode)或音频功能
- 大功率双向供电:实现100W PD协议供电/受电切换
典型案例:4K视频采集卡、移动固态硬盘、高端扩展坞
2.2 16P的最佳应用场景
这类"够用就好"的场景最适合16P方案:
- 仅需USB2.0数据传输(480Mbps)
- 支持PD快充但无需视频输出
- 产品尺寸受限但需要完整CC控制
典型应用:
- 智能家居中控(如温控器)
- 工业HMI设备
- 中端机械键盘
2.3 6P的经济型方案
以下场景可考虑极简的6P配置:
- 纯供电设备(如电动牙刷)
- 无数据传输的充电底座
- 对成本极度敏感的消费电子产品
警告:选用6P时需确认充电器兼容性,部分PD充电器需要检测数据引脚
3. PD协议实现的硬件关键点
3.1 CC引脚的三种配置模式
通过CC引脚电阻配置可实现不同功率协商:
| 电阻值 | 模式 | 最大电流 | 典型应用 |
|---|---|---|---|
| 5.1kΩ | 默认USB | 500mA | 基础充电 |
| 1.2kΩ | PD协议使能 | 3A | 快充设备 |
| 680Ω | 专用充电口 | 1.5A | 充电宝输入 |
// 典型PD控制器初始化代码(STM32示例) void PD_Init(void) { GPIO_InitTypeDef GPIO_InitStruct = {0}; // CC1/CC2引脚配置 GPIO_InitStruct.Pin = GPIO_PIN_4|GPIO_PIN_5; GPIO_InitStruct.Mode = GPIO_MODE_ANALOG; GPIO_InitStruct.Pull = GPIO_NOPULL; HAL_GPIO_Init(GPIOA, &GPIO_InitStruct); // 配置PD协议芯片 PD_IC_Reset(); PD_SetVoltageRange(5, 20); PD_SetCurrentLimit(3000); }3.2 常见设计陷阱与解决方案
死机充电问题
现象:设备充电时MCU复位
原因:VBUS上电冲击超过LDO耐受范围
方案:增加TVS二极管+PTC组合保护PD握手失败
现象:只能5V充电无法触发快充
检查点:- CC引脚走线长度差<5mm
- 阻容器件精度需≥1%
- 确认Ra电阻未虚焊
EMI超标
高频信号线处理要点:- 差分对阻抗控制在90Ω±10%
- 相邻信号线间距≥2倍线宽
- 避免在电源层上方走线
4. 实战选型决策流程图
根据产品需求快速定位合适方案的决策树:
graph TD A[需要USB3.0/视频输出?] -->|是| B[24P方案] A -->|否| C[需要数据传输?] C -->|是| D[16P方案] C -->|否| E[仅供电需求?] E -->|是| F[评估6P方案] E -->|否| G[重新定义需求]配套的物料选型清单建议:
24P推荐型号:
- 立讯精密(Luxshare)0912-24P
- 莫仕(Molex)47642-0241
16P性价比之选:
- 长盈精密(Everwin)TC-16M-SMT
- 日本航空电子(JAE)DX07S024JJ3
6P经济型选择:
- 正崴精密(Foxlink)FPCN-6P-TH
- 电连技术(ECT)ECS-106-G
最后分享一个真实案例:某智能门锁团队最初为节省成本选用6P接口,结果发现无法兼容市面上70%的PD充电器。后来改用16P方案并优化CC电路,BOM成本仅增加1.2元,但客户满意度提升40%。这个教训告诉我们——接口选型不是简单的成本算术题,而是系统体验的基石。